Typically, we auction 13-week and 26-week bills on Monday, the 17-week on Wednesday, and 4-week and 8-week bills on Thursday. We auction the 52-week bill every four weeks. Cash management bills aren't auctioned according to a schedule. For specific dates, see our Tentative Auction Schedule, which shows auction dates months in advance, or ...

The knob you can twist is duration. You can sell, e.g., a T-bill maturing in 4 weeks, and buy a 26-week T-bill if you want to increase the duration in exchange for a yield you find more attractive. Many bond funds do exactly that. They purposely sell bonds before maturity in order to achieve a higher yield, or at least a higher duration.

Price = Face Value / (1 + (Discount Rate * Days to Maturity / 360)) Face Value is the value of the T-bill at maturity. Discount Rate is the annualized interest rate. Days to Maturity is the number of days until the bill matures (usually 30, 60, or 90 days). If you hold a bill in TreasuryDirect, you can use the proceeds from the maturing bill to buy another bill of the same term. This is a reinvestment. For instance, if you own a 52-week bill, you can use its proceeds to reinvest into another 52-week bill. Using the example above of buying a $100 bill for $95, when it matures the $5 goes to your bank account and the $95 is used to buy the next round. There are very slight variations to this but that’s the basic idea. If the new $100 bill rate is higher and only costs $94, they will send you back $6. In addition to Treasury bills, there are other Treasury securities to ... best lump sum cancer insurance All 10-year notes are generally auctioned during the second week of the above-mentioned months and are issued on the 15th of the same month. If the 15th falls on a Saturday, Sunday, or federal holiday, the securities are issued on the next business day.
